Test from sheet:
Most transformation is based of some form of melting,
though ice and steam are also acceptable.
Water based, NOT goo.
The ability to take on various shapes comes very naturally.
As if poured into an invisible glass, he simply fills in the shape.
In the new shapes he chooses to retain his “fur pattern”, but he
can change his colors easily as well.
All parts of the melted form are still his own, no true "core" exists,
but dilution and continued splitting and separating of his form
can cause him problems.
Small bits that were removed can remain under his control
with enough effort, but may be "scrapped" if it is deemed
unnecessary to retrieve the portion.
Additional mass can be gained from soaking in water,
OR people. No true consumption of their form is done,
just a merging and melting down of the new fusion form.
Hayaikawa retains full control of the combined mass, but may
allow the partner control of their form. Be it shared or full.
This can allow him to transform other, as if painting over them.
This transformation is not magic and has no time limit, but a true
biological remaking of them. Though it can be easily undone if desired.
Due to the mental effort needed to take on the various forms,
Hayaikawa often needs to melt down to liquid when he sleeps.
He prefers his specially designed bowl, since any bed would
simply soak him up and require a few hours effort to remove himself.
